Post by Chips_Away_Windshield_Repair »

I buy some hobby stuff on ebay, music, crafts. Pleased most of the time but shafted once or twice.

I almost bought several Fleetguard brand filters for a third of Cummins price. Came to find out they were counterfit with filter material inside that could destroy a diesel engine.

Bought a $30.00 WSR bridge and injector claimed to be similar to Delta, I knew better but just had to blow the dough I guess, got what I paid for.

Resins from the main WSR supply mfgr's are pretty complex formulations by chemists knowing the quality of their products will keep customers coming back to them for supplies.

Something as important as the raw material for your business success is not worth trying to save a buck on something you know nothing about.

Go with products that have a proven track record.
